How to unlock the Enchanter class in Fire Emblem Engage

If you were hoping to use the new classes during the Fell Xenologue, you might have to wait a bit. While the fourth DLC of the Expansion Pass is bringing a lot of things, you’ll need to be patient before trying all of them in the main story. To unlock the Enchanter class in Fire Emblem Engage, you’ll need to do the following:

  • Reach Chapter 6 of the Main Story
  • Unlock the Fell Xenologue by going to the Ancient Well
  • Complete the Fell Xenologue to receive the Mystic Satchel

This last item is the one that’ll let you unlock the new class. We don’t know if it’ll be a one-time use or if you’ll be able to buy it from the store, or if, once unlocked, you’ll only need a Second or Master Seal. Still, it is nice to see that the game is giving you a great reward for finishing the new story.

Some people were looking forward to using the new class during the DLC, but it seems that won’t be the case. Still, if you’re a new player, you should consider unlocking this class to use it for the rest of the main story. As you know, there are many characters to recruit in the game, and some of them will benefit from this class. So far, we know that the Enchanter class will use Arts and Daggers, which makes one terrific combination. Some characters with high speed and dexterity might benefit from it, but we’ll have to wait and check the final builds.
